Output 85babf28436a52f67528b385ec6a4ada6c65dec646c83393c694eee54eaaf2ec:2

value
1242577514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7430d17ad0edd85a2df9b14f62ac5c36e72aa92 OP_EQUALVERIFY OP_CHECKSIG
address
1KAbnyDky6yaGaYAU3BqepgPKo8fZk3b1C
transaction
85babf28436a52f67528b385ec6a4ada6c65dec646c83393c694eee54eaaf2ec
spent
true